    What is the most efficient means of acclimating a piece of coral without adding the bag water to your aquarium? Take for example, sponges, who can not be exposed to air. What have you found to be the best means of acclimation?

    I use an extra overflow box to do all of my acclimation. With sponges I have the LFS add extra water into the bag, cut from the bottom, drain some water into the overflow until there is enough to cover the sponge, then drop the sponge in from the bottom. Then I remove some of the LFS water and start adding my tank water.
